About Chipping Hill
Chipping Hill is a pleasant residential area located in Essex, England, within the CM8 postcode area. This community is situated just to the north of the town of Witham, offering a peaceful environment while still being conveniently close to local amenities. The area features a mix of housing styles, making it suitable for families and individuals alike. The surrounding countryside provides opportunities for leisurely walks and outdoor activities, allowing residents to enjoy the natural beauty of Essex. With good transport links, Chipping Hill is well-connected to nearby towns and cities, making it an ideal location for those who commute. The local schools and community facilities contribute to a supportive atmosphere, making it a welcoming place to live.
School Ratings in Chipping Hill
Families in Chipping Hill have access to 29 local schools. Southview School and Chatten Free School are each rated Outstanding by Ofsted. A further 13 schools hold a Good rating.
House Prices in Chipping Hill
Homes sell for an average of £352K locally. Most of the housing is made up of terraced houses, averaging £276K.
Crime and Anti-Social Behaviour in Chipping Hill
Crime in the area is broadly in line with the national average. Other theft is the leading concern across Chipping Hill, with 14 incidents recorded in January 2026.
